What Makes a Good Drop Away Arrow Rest? Key Features Explained
A quality drop away projectile rest is essential for repeatable archery results . Several key attributes influence its worth. Initially, look for a strong design that reduces unwanted shift during the sequence. Secondly , a effortless lowering action is imperative to ensure the arrow avoids the apparatus grip and cord cleanly. Lastly , flexible settings for elevation click here and horizontal alignment are advantageous to fine-tune the system for varying shaft weights and draw lengths .

Drop Away Compound Rests: Features, Kinds , and Setup
Drop away arrow rests have become ever more favored among archers seeking a more consistent release. These rests permit the string to clear away from the projectile after release, minimizing friction and boosting accuracy . There are several types available , including plate rests which give a secure platform, plastic rests that gently drop away, and rotating rests which rotate during the release. Setting up can vary according to the specific type ; however, it generally involves securing the rest to the bow’s frame using fasteners and carefully setting the travel distance.
